Hit Me Baby One More Time: When Ed Sheeran Made Music Better

Who can take an already-perfect song and make it better? Ed Sheeran.

This hit maker, besides having a string of chart-toppers himself, has over 30 covers of popular songs (compiled into a YouTube playlist by a generous Ed Sheeran fan, here, thank you!)  that he’s reworked in his own unique style and made them sound completely new, different , and I dare say, better.

Ed’s acoustic covers of these tracks go from Hozier to Cee-lo Greene, and from Adele to Oasis, and now, even Fetty Wap. (Applause, applause).

It seems like there’s precious little that this flame-haired artist cannot pull off (I wish the flame hair were gone, though. Blonde is his color.) with his unimaginable vocal talent. Here’s a selection of five of his best covers:

  1. Wonderwall – Oasis

 

Ed’s rendition of Wonderwall is a much mellower version of Oasis’s original 1995 release. The drastic difference in the mood of the two versions make Ed’s version sound almost like a new song.

  1. Someone Like You – Adele

Ed Sheeran took the beautiful Someone Like You, and instilled a whole new vibe to it. This one is a welcome variant of Adele’s Operatic original, and has fans swooning over it.

(https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=KJu_eQCHRHI)

  1. Take me to Church – Hozier

Perhaps the best of the very best listed here, this version of Hozier’s Take Me to Church recorded for BBC Radio is soulful beyond measure.
